Why Bulk Purchasing Matters for Desulfurizers

Before we jump into negotiation tactics, let's talk about why buying desulfurization machines in bulk is worth the effort. For starters, desulfurizers aren't standalone tools. They're part of a larger ecosystem: your lead acid battery breaking and separation system crushes and sorts batteries, the rotary furnace for paste reduction melts the lead paste, and the desulfurization unit ensures the sulfur dioxide and other gases are neutralized before release. When you purchase these components together—or even just multiple desulfurization machines for scaling up—suppliers often offer volume discounts. It's simple economics: larger orders mean lower per-unit production costs for them, and they're willing to pass some of that savings on to you.

Bulk buying also gives you leverage. Suppliers prioritize customers who commit to larger orders, which means you're more likely to get preferential treatment: faster delivery times, dedicated technical support, and even customizations. I once worked with a client who needed three desulfurization units instead of one. By negotiating a bulk purchase, they not only saved 12% on the machines themselves but also secured a free training session for their operators and priority access to replacement parts—perks that would have cost an extra $5,000 if bought separately.

Finally, bulk purchasing future-proofs your operation. As your recycling plant grows, demand for desulfurization capacity will too. Buying extra units now (or locking in a price for future orders) protects you from inflation and supply chain disruptions. Remember 2021, when lead acid battery recycling equipment prices spiked due to metal shortages? Plants that had pre-negotiated bulk contracts avoided those hikes entirely. The key is to approach bulk buying strategically—not just as a cost-cutting move, but as an investment in your plant's resilience.

Tip 1: Start by Mapping Your Exact Needs (No Guesswork Allowed)

You wouldn't buy a car without knowing how many passengers you need to carry or how far you'll drive each day. The same logic applies to desulfurization machines. Before you even pick up the phone to negotiate, you need to map your exact requirements. This clarity not only helps you avoid overbuying (or underbuying) but also gives you confidence at the negotiating table. Suppliers can smell uncertainty, and they'll use it to upsell you on features you don't need.

Start with the basics: What's your plant's current capacity? If you process 500 kg of lead acid batteries per hour, a desulfurization unit with a 600 kg/h capacity might be enough. But if you're planning to expand to 1,000 kg/h next year, you'll need a higher-capacity machine—or two smaller ones for redundancy. I always tell clients to ask: "What's the worst-case scenario?" If one desulfurization unit breaks down, can the other keep up with demand? If not, downtime could cost you $2,000 per hour in lost revenue. That's a detail worth factoring into your purchase quantity.

Next, consider compatibility. Your desulfurization machine needs to work seamlessly with your existing equipment, like the rotary furnace for paste reduction and air pollution control system. For example, if your furnace operates at 800°C, the desulfurization unit must handle gases at that temperature without efficiency drops. Mismatched equipment leads to inefficiencies—and suppliers will try to sell you "upgrades" to fix the problem. By knowing your specs upfront, you can push back: "Our current furnace runs at 800°C. Will this desulfurization unit work with that, or do you have a model that does?" This kind of specificity shows suppliers you're prepared, and they'll take your negotiation more seriously.

Finally, think about long-term costs. A cheaper desulfurization machine might have lower upfront prices, but higher energy consumption or frequent filter replacements. Calculate the total cost of ownership (TCO) over 5 years: purchase price + energy + maintenance + parts. I helped a client compare two units: one cost $80,000 upfront with $5,000/year in upkeep, and another cost $100,000 with $1,000/year in upkeep. The pricier one saved them $20,000 over 5 years. Armed with this data, they negotiated the supplier down to $90,000—proving that preparation pays off.

Tip 2: Vet Suppliers Like You're Hiring a Team Member

Not all desulfurization machine suppliers are created equal. Some cut corners on materials; others overpromise on after-sales service. To negotiate effectively, you need to separate the reliable partners from the rest. This isn't just about checking Google reviews—it's about digging into their track record, customer support, and willingness to collaborate.

Start by asking for references. A reputable supplier will happily connect you with 3-5 current customers. When you call these references, ask tough questions: "How long did it take to get the machine delivered?" "Has the supplier followed through on warranty claims?" "If you had to do it over, would you buy from them again?" I once spoke to a reference who admitted, "The machine works, but their tech support takes 3 days to respond. We lost a week of production when a part failed." That's a red flag worth walking away from—even if the price is low.

To help you compare suppliers, I've put together a sample comparison table based on real data from the lead acid battery recycling industry:

Supplier Desulfurization Unit Price (Bulk of 3) Capacity (kg/h) After-Sales Service Response Time Bundled Equipment
Supplier A $220,000 ($73,333/unit) 800 24-hour Rotary furnace, air pollution control system (10% discount on bundle)
Supplier B $195,000 ($65,000/unit) 700 48-hour No bundled options
Supplier C $240,000 ($80,000/unit) 1,000 12-hour Lead acid battery breaking and separation system (15% discount on bundle)

At first glance, Supplier B seems cheapest, but their lower capacity and slower service might cost you in the long run. Supplier A, despite a higher per-unit price, offers a bundle discount that could save you even more if you need a rotary furnace. This table isn't just about comparing numbers—it's about aligning with a supplier who meets your priorities, whether that's speed, capacity, or bundled equipment.

Tip 3: Bundle Desulfurizers with Complementary Equipment

Here's a secret most buyers miss: Suppliers love selling bundles. When you purchase desulfurization machines alongside other equipment—like air pollution control system equipment, lead acid battery breaking and separation systems, or even auxiliary tools—you become a higher-value customer, and they'll slash prices to close the deal. I've seen clients save 15-20% by bundling, which adds up to tens of thousands of dollars on large orders.

Let's say you need three desulfurization units and an air pollution control system. Instead of buying them separately from two suppliers, ask one supplier to quote a bundle price. Why? Because the supplier's profit margin on multiple products is higher than on a single machine, so they're willing to reduce the total cost to win your business. For example, a supplier might charge $80,000 for one desulfurization unit and $150,000 for an air pollution control system. But if you buy three desulfurization units ($240,000) and the control system ($150,000), they might offer the whole bundle for $350,000—a $40,000 discount—because the combined profit is still healthy.

Tip 4: Lock in Long-Term Contracts for Price Stability

In the recycling equipment industry, prices fluctuate—metal costs rise, supply chains get disrupted, and new regulations drive up manufacturing expenses. One way to protect yourself is to negotiate a long-term contract with a supplier. By committing to buy desulfurization machines (or other equipment) over 2-3 years, you can lock in today's prices and avoid future hikes. Suppliers love long-term contracts because they guarantee steady revenue, so they'll often offer discounts or price caps to secure them.

For example, let's say you need five desulfurization units over the next three years: two now, and one each year after. Instead of buying two units today at $75,000 each and risking paying $85,000 per unit next year, ask the supplier for a contract that locks in the $75,000 price for all five units. In exchange, you'll commit to purchasing exclusively from them for desulfurizers during that period. Suppliers will often agree because they avoid the cost of re-marketing to you each year, and they can plan production more efficiently.

When drafting the contract, include a "price cap" clause. This ensures that even if material costs spike by 10%, your price only increases by 3%—or not at all. I once helped a client negotiate a cap of 5% annual increase, which saved them $22,000 when steel prices jumped 12% the following year. The supplier grumbled a little, but they honored the contract because losing a long-term customer would hurt more than the temporary loss in profit.

Tip 5: Negotiate Payment Terms (Yes, Even on Bulk Orders)

Price isn't the only negotiable factor—payment terms can save you just as much money, especially on bulk orders. Instead of paying 50% upfront and 50% on delivery (the industry standard), ask for better terms: 30% upfront, 30% on delivery, and 40% after 30 days of operation. This way, you're not paying the full amount until you're sure the machines work as promised.

Suppliers may push back, saying, "We need cash flow to build the machines." But remember: You're placing a large order, which is a low-risk investment for them. Offer a compromise: "We'll pay 40% upfront if you agree to 20% on delivery and 40% after 30 days." Most will accept because they want the order, and the upfront payment covers their material costs.

Another trick: Ask for a discount for early payment. If you can afford to pay 100% upfront, suppliers might knock off 3-5% for the guaranteed cash. For a $300,000 order, that's $9,000-$15,000 in savings. Just make sure the machines are tested and approved before paying in full—you don't want to be stuck with faulty equipment and no leverage.
